Hi! Melody

Can add more mystery to your man, that is if it is the one you are looking for.  You say he married Emily in 1866, this is a family I found on the 1881 census Henry is married to an Emily and he was born Folkstone in Kent.

They are living at Highfield Road, Steads Buildings, Hemsworth, York

Henry            Age 36     B. Folkstone      Coal Miner
Emily             Age 36     B. Lichfield
Charles         Age 18     B. Lichfield         Pony Driver in Pit
Mary Ann       Age 14     B. Lichfield
Alice              Age 12     B. Standbridge     Scholar
Harry            Age 10      B. Cotham, York   Scholar
Herbert Wm. Age 8       B. Rosedale Abby, York   Scholar
Enoch            Age 7       B. Prolton,Cleveland       Scholar
Gabriel           Age 1      B. Fairburn, York
Edward          Age 2M   B. Hemsworth

You will find this on the 1881 census on the follwoing site

1851 Great Gonerby, Lincolnshire

Catherine PRICE head mar 47 b.Limstead Herts
Henry son 7 b.Folkestone Kent
Albert KELLAM son in law mar? 28 tailor b.Waltham Leicestershire
Ann Maria mar 24 b.Bloomfield Staffordshire
Abraham 2 b.Golds Green Staffordshire
Arthur lodger unm 23 cordwainer b.Foston Lincolnshire
Joseph COSEBY lodger mar 34 miner b.Northampton
Ann lodger mar 23 b.Liverpool
Thomas lodger 5 b.Barington France?

HO107/2103 folio 61 page 3
